The long-anticipated “Highlander” revamp is nearing its production phase with the acclaimed Henry Cavill slated for the lead role.
Chad Stahelski, the cinematic maestro who gave us the John Wick series, has been laboring over the “Highlander” revamp for a near-decade and is champing at the bit to get it off the ground.
Despite the original’s modest theatrical performance, Stahelski is revved up about breathing new life into his fresh take on the story.

The protracted journey of the “Highlander” revamp from concept to creation seems to be approaching a major milestone, with the project’s helmsman indicating that the production wheels are poised to start turning. Set to fill the shoes of the original’s protagonist, Connor McLeod, initially brought to life by Christopher Lambert in the 1986 debut, is none other than Henry Cavill. In an engaging exchange with FilmSweep’s Nate Richard, Chad Stahelski shed light on the reboot’s timeline, hinting at an imminent start to shooting:

We’re not circling a specific date yet, but if I were a betting man, I’d wager it’ll be sometime within the next 365 days. [Chuckles] In the not-too-distant future. As quickly as I can make it happen. It’s like juggling with two beloved projects at once: “Ghost of Tsushima” and “Highlander,” those are my babies. There are a few other projects warming up in the bullpen like “Rainbow Six” among others, but those are still simmering in the scriptwriting phase. “Highlander” has been my passion project for a whopping eight years. It’s high on my list. All the pieces seem to be falling into place, and assuming we can glide past this strike, with our timetables syncing up, it’s looking very promising indeed.

Russell Mulcahy’s initial “Highlander” outing may not have set the box office alight, but the fascination with this narrative of undying warriors hasn’t waned within the film-making sphere. There was a time when Dave Bautista was roped into the project, but as the reboot hit a series of snags over time, Bautista moved on to other ventures. Stahelski, even prior to his engagements with the latter John Wick chapters, has been the driving force behind this title, with Cavill climbing aboard a few years back.

The inaugural “Highlander” film saw Connor McLeod don the wrestler’s mantle, engaging in a post-match sword duel against Iman Fasil (portrayed by Peter Diamond). However, we soon learn that McLeod’s tale stretches back centuries, having lived lifetimes over, perpetually on the move and seemingly immune to death’s final touch. His narrative takes a twist when he encounters Juan Sánchez-Villalobos Ramírez (Sean Connery), who brings with him a foreboding message — in the end, only one immortal may stand, and their kind must maintain equilibrium.

At the director’s chair, Chad Stahelski, the visionary behind John Wick, is gearing up to catapult “Highlander” into a new epoch. The production’s delay, partly due to the pandemic’s ripple effects through Hollywood, is finally seeing a break in the clouds with this promising forecast. Lionsgate, the film’s distributor, has yet to carve out a release date for the “Highlander” revamp, but all signs point to forward momentum.
